Major Departure Ports and Terminal Layout The geography of New York cruise operations is centered primarily around Manhattan and Brooklyn. The peak season spans from late spring through early fall, during which the waters are warmer and the Caribbean is easily accessible.
Industry experts recommend initiating the planning process six to nine months in advance for standard itineraries. For high-demand sailings, such as those around major holidays or featuring popular destinations, looking even further ahead is the most effective strategy to secure favorable rates and preferred stateroom locations.
